PTA CALIFORNIA CONGRESS OF PARENTS MONTEREY HILLS, founded in 2012, is a small nonprofit that reported $117K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 21%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$31K, a strong 27% operating margin.

Mission

THE EDUCATIONAL ENVIRONMENT WAS ENHANCED FOR THE TEACHERS, STUDENTS AND STAFF OF THE MONETEREY HILLS ELEMENTARY SCHOOL THROUGH THE CONTRIBUTION OF BOOKS, CLASSROOM ENRICHMENT PROGRAMS, TECHNOLOGY, SCHOOL SUPPLIES, FIELD TRIPS, CULTURAL ARTS ASSEMBLIES, ART PROGRAMS, SCIENCE FAIR.
